NSW truckie arrested over workplace death

The managing director of a NSW freight company where an employee died after a brutal punch-up with a truck driver is remaining tight-lipped about the incident.

The fight allegedly broke out between a truck driver and a forklift operator at Crawfords Freightlines in Sandgate on Tuesday afternoon.

The 45-year-old forklift driver was pronounced dead at John Hunter Hospital, shortly after emergency services found him at the industrial site unconscious having been violently punched several times.

The truck driver, 44, has been charged with assault causing death, and is due to face Newcastle Local Court on Wednesday afternoon.

An autopsy will be carried out to determine how the man died.

Crawfords Freightlines managing director Peter Crawford has asked people to "respect the family of the man who was killed".

It is the second death at the freight company site after a fatality occurred there last month which being investigated.
